New & popular freewith Touchscreen support tagged Open World (68 results)
Explore games with Touchscreen support tagged Open World on itch.io. Games that typically contain a large world that you are free to explore in any order you like. Completing objects may op · Upload your games with Touchscreen support to itch.io to have them show up here.
New itch.io is now on YouTube!
Subscribe for game recommendations, clips, and more
View Channel
Solve cryptic language puzzles in the mountains of New Rollinsport. Discover your identity.
Puzzle
Online zombie survival and other games such as open world survival!
Survival
Play in browser
Medieval, No-fantasy, Historical, Cross-Play microMO RPG! Oldschool vibe!
Role Playing
Open world supernatural game. Take your revenge on the demons in New Celeste.
Adventure
Play in browser
Conquer the world in a multiplayer turn-based strategy and tactical war game
Strategy
Play in browser
Open-World, Cross-Platform, Mulitplayer Drifting Game
Racing
A classic game, stuffed with as many unnecessary features as possible
Shooter
Play in browser
Bicycle games go 3D! Experience the thrill of BMX and MTB in our bike game!
Sports
Join the virtual version of Liberland, chat, discover planned projects, collaborate, and become part of the movement.
A fun Life Simulator that includes a dynamically evolving Openworld
Simulation
Journey through Hanyem as Pike Gilder and his boar companion, Tusk, in this simple turn-based RPG!
Adventure
Play in browser
um projeto de um fan game de Made In Abyss baseado em Binary Star
Adventure
World first full-fledged real-time MMORPG for your browser
Role Playing
Play in browser
Immersive VR installation for Smartphone, Tablet and PC
Educational
Play in browser
Throwback adventure RPG with 77 fun missions and an original score!
Adventure
A procedurally generated, text-based fantasy RPG
Interactive Fiction
Play in browser
The best 3D Open World Sandbox game, explore the city, drive, and more
Action
Rule your civilization, expand your empire, fight or cooperate with thousands of online players...
Strategy
Loading more games...